Out Now: Annual Report 2020

The annual report of IAMANEH Switzerland is freshly printed! Here are a few samples of what we have achieved: 9'414 women and children received protection, care and counseling in women's shelters we supported in the Western Balkans and West Africa. We reached 11,105 people with our awareness-raising work in the fight against female genital mutilation in West Africa. We distributed 9,000 reusable protective masks, 1,800 liters of disinfectant and 1,800kg of soap in West Africa for pandemic response. The annual report is available for download on the IAMANEH Switzerland website.

SUPPORT THE INITIATIVE AGAINST US FIGHTER JETS NOW

Last fall, only a razor-thin majority approved the purchase of new fighter jets - even though the type issue was deliberately left out. Soon it will be clear which fighter jet the Federal Council wants to purchase. If the choice falls on a US fighter jet, we will launch a popular initiative to stop this procurement. We also reserve the right to launch an initiative against any procurement should there be any glaring inconsistencies.

Protection Mechanism for Human Rights Defenders in Honduras: Review after Five Years

Last November, Honduras underwent its third Universal Periodic Review (UPR) at the UN Human Rights Council. Among the most lauded advances was the creation of the National Protection Mechanism in 2015, but despite some achievements, there is still much to be done five years later.

No loopholes in the arms export ban

The "Korrekturinitiative" wants to prevent Switzerland from exporting war material to civil war countries. The Federal Council rejects the initiative. However, it is submitting an indirect counter-proposal that takes up the concern in principle but allows it to deviate from the export ban under certain circumstances. Such a loophole is unacceptable to the initiators; withdrawing the initiative is thus out of the question.
